_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load

Description

Signature

/// Requires Capability Set 1:
T _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load(
    vector<int, isArray+Shape.dimensions+1> location)
    where T : ITexelElement
    where Shape : __ITextureShape
    where isMS == 0
    where access == 0;

/// Requires Capability Set 2:
T _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load(
    vector<int, isArray+Shape.dimensions+1> location,
    vector<int, Shape.planeDimensions> offset)
    where T : ITexelElement
    where Shape : __ITextureShape
    where isMS == 0
    where access == 0;

/// Requires Capability Set 3:
T _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load(
    vector<int, isArray+Shape.dimensions+1> location,
    vector<int, Shape.planeDimensions> offset,
    out uint status)
    where T : ITexelElement
    where Shape : __ITextureShape
    where isMS == 0
    where access == 0;

/// Requires Capability Set 4:
T _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load(
    vector<int, isArray+Shape.dimensions> location,
    int sampleIndex)
    where T : ITexelElement
    where Shape : __ITextureShape
    where isMS == 1
    where access == 0;

/// Requires Capability Set 5:
T _Texture<T, Shape, isArray, isMS, sampleCount, access, isShadow, isCombined, format>.Load(
    vector<int, isArray+Shape.dimensions+1> locationAndSampleIndex)
    where T : ITexelElement
    where Shape : __ITextureShape
    where isMS == 1
    where access == 0;
